而微软公司的Hyper-V,作为Windows Server内置的高级虚拟化平台,凭借其强大的功能、出色的性能和便捷的管理性,赢得了众多企业和开发者的青睐
然而,对于初次接触Hyper-V的用户来说,虚拟机安装的过程可能显得既神秘又复杂,他们往往关心的一个核心问题就是:“Hyper-V虚拟机安装需要多久?” 本文将全面解析Hyper-V虚拟机安装的各个步骤,结合实际操作经验,提供一个相对准确的时间预估,并分享一些优化安装过程的技巧,帮助用户更加高效地完成Hyper-V虚拟机的部署
一、准备工作:奠定坚实基础 1. 系统要求检查(约5-10分钟) 在着手安装之前,确保你的硬件和软件环境满足Hyper-V的基本要求至关重要
这包括检查CPU是否支持虚拟化技术(如Intel的VT-x或AMD的AMD-V)、内存是否足够(至少4GB,推荐8GB以上)、硬盘空间是否充裕(每个虚拟机至少需要几十GB的空间),以及操作系统版本是否支持Hyper-V角色(Windows Server 2012及以上版本,或Windows 10/11的专业版、企业版或教育版)
2. BIOS/UEFI设置调整(约5-15分钟) 进入计算机的BIOS或UEFI设置界面,确保启用了CPU虚拟化技术(通常称为Intel VT-d或AMD SVM)
这一步虽然简单,但常被忽略,是导致Hyper-V无法正确安装或运行的常见原因之一
二、安装Hyper-V角色:核心步骤详解 1. 启用Hyper-V功能(约5-10分钟) 在Windows Server或符合条件的Windows客户端系统上,通过“服务器管理器”或“控制面板”中的“程序和功能”添加Hyper-V角色
系统会自动下载并安装必要的组件,期间可能需要重启计算机以完成安装
2. Hyper-V管理器配置(约10-20分钟) 安装完成后,打开“Hyper-V管理器”,开始配置虚拟机网络、存储等资源
这包括创建虚拟交换机(用于虚拟机与外部网络的通信)、设置虚拟机存储位置(建议使用单独的磁盘或分区以提高性能)
这些配置虽耗时,但为后续的虚拟机部署打下了坚实的基础
三、创建并配置虚拟机:细节决定成败 1. 新建虚拟机向导(约15-30分钟) 在Hyper-V管理器中,启动新建虚拟机向导,按照提示输入虚拟机名称、分配内存、选择操作系统类型(及ISO镜像文件路径,如果计划从光盘安装)、配置硬盘大小等
每一步都需要仔细核对,特别是内存和硬盘分配,直接影响到虚拟机的性能
2. 安装操作系统(视操作系统而异,约30分钟至数小时不等) 一旦虚拟机配置完成,就可以启动虚拟机并安装操作系统了
这个时间取决于所选操作系统的安装复杂度、ISO镜像的读写速度以及宿主机的硬件配置
例如,安装Windows Server操作系统通常需要30分钟到1小时,而Linux发行版则可能因发行版和配置选项的不同而有所差异
3. 安装虚拟机工具(约5-15分钟) 为了提高虚拟机性能,如鼠标指针平滑移动、时间同步、文件共享等,建议在虚拟机内安装Hyper-V Integration Services(对于Windows虚拟机)或相应的Linux虚拟化工具
这些工具的安装通常快速且简单,只需跟随向导操作即可
四、优化与调试:提升用户体验 1. 调整虚拟机设置(约5-15分钟) 根据实际需求,调整虚拟机的CPU分配、内存限制、网络带宽等设置,以达到最佳性能平衡
同时,检查并优化虚拟硬盘的存储路径和格式,确保读写速度满足应用需求
2. 备份与恢复测试(约15-30分钟) 部署完成后,进行虚拟机备